gpt4 book ai didi

org.opendaylight.yangtools.odlext.model.api.YangModeledAnyXmlSchemaNode类的使用及代码示例

转载 作者:知者 更新时间:2024-03-16 01:05:31 26 4
gpt4 key购买 nike

本文整理了Java中org.opendaylight.yangtools.odlext.model.api.YangModeledAnyXmlSchemaNode类的一些代码示例,展示了YangModeledAnyXmlSchemaNode类的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。YangModeledAnyXmlSchemaNode类的具体详情如下:
包路径:org.opendaylight.yangtools.odlext.model.api.YangModeledAnyXmlSchemaNode
类名称:YangModeledAnyXmlSchemaNode

YangModeledAnyXmlSchemaNode介绍

[英]The "YangModeledAnyXml" interface defines an interior node in the schema tree. It takes one argument, which is an identifier represented by QName inherited from SchemaNode, followed by a block of substatements that holds detailed anyxml information. The substatements are defined in DataSchemaNode. The "YangModeledAnyXml" in contrast to the "AnyXml" interface can also provide schema of contained XML information.

This interface was modeled according to definition in [RFC-6020] The anyxml Statement
[中]“YangModeledAnyXml”接口在模式树中定义了一个内部节点。它使用一个参数,这是一个由从SchemaAnode继承的QName表示的标识符,后跟一个包含详细的anyxml信息的子语句块。子状态在DataSchemaNode中定义。与“AnyXml”接口相比,“YangModeledAnyXml”还可以提供包含XML信息的模式。
这个接口是根据[RFC-6020] The anyxml Statement中的定义建模的

代码示例

代码示例来源:origin: opendaylight/yangtools

private ImmutableYangModeledAnyXmlNodeBuilder(final YangModeledAnyXmlSchemaNode yangModeledAnyXMLSchemaNode,
    final int sizeHint) {
  super(sizeHint);
  requireNonNull(yangModeledAnyXMLSchemaNode, "Yang modeled any xml node must not be null.");
  super.withNodeIdentifier(NodeIdentifier.create(yangModeledAnyXMLSchemaNode.getQName()));
  this.contentSchema = yangModeledAnyXMLSchemaNode.getSchemaOfAnyXmlData();
}

代码示例来源:origin: org.opendaylight.yangtools/yang-data-impl

public SchemaNode startYangModeledAnyXmlNode(final NodeIdentifier name) {
  LOG.debug("Enter yang modeled anyXml {}", name);
  final SchemaNode schema = getSchema(name);
  checkArgument(schema instanceof YangModeledAnyXmlSchemaNode, "Node %s is not an yang modeled anyXml.",
    schema.getPath());
  schemaStack.push(((YangModeledAnyXmlSchemaNode) schema).getSchemaOfAnyXmlData());
  return schema;
}

代码示例来源:origin: opendaylight/yangtools

public SchemaNode startYangModeledAnyXmlNode(final NodeIdentifier name) {
  LOG.debug("Enter yang modeled anyXml {}", name);
  final SchemaNode schema = getSchema(name);
  checkArgument(schema instanceof YangModeledAnyXmlSchemaNode, "Node %s is not an yang modeled anyXml.",
    schema.getPath());
  schemaStack.push(((YangModeledAnyXmlSchemaNode) schema).getSchemaOfAnyXmlData());
  return schema;
}

代码示例来源:origin: org.opendaylight.yangtools/yang-data-impl

private ImmutableYangModeledAnyXmlNodeBuilder(final YangModeledAnyXmlSchemaNode yangModeledAnyXMLSchemaNode) {
  requireNonNull(yangModeledAnyXMLSchemaNode, "Yang modeled any xml node must not be null.");
  super.withNodeIdentifier(NodeIdentifier.create(yangModeledAnyXMLSchemaNode.getQName()));
  this.contentSchema = yangModeledAnyXMLSchemaNode.getSchemaOfAnyXmlData();
}

代码示例来源:origin: opendaylight/yangtools

parentSchema = ((YangModeledAnyXmlSchemaNode) parentSchema).getSchemaOfAnyXmlData();

代码示例来源:origin: org.opendaylight.yangtools/yang-data-impl

private ImmutableYangModeledAnyXmlNodeBuilder(final YangModeledAnyXmlSchemaNode yangModeledAnyXMLSchemaNode,
    final int sizeHint) {
  super(sizeHint);
  requireNonNull(yangModeledAnyXMLSchemaNode, "Yang modeled any xml node must not be null.");
  super.withNodeIdentifier(NodeIdentifier.create(yangModeledAnyXMLSchemaNode.getQName()));
  this.contentSchema = yangModeledAnyXMLSchemaNode.getSchemaOfAnyXmlData();
}

代码示例来源:origin: org.opendaylight.yangtools/yang-data-codec-gson

DataSchemaNode parentSchema = parent.getSchema();
if (parentSchema instanceof YangModeledAnyXmlSchemaNode) {
  parentSchema = ((YangModeledAnyXmlSchemaNode) parentSchema).getSchemaOfAnyXmlData();

代码示例来源:origin: opendaylight/yangtools

private ImmutableYangModeledAnyXmlNodeBuilder(final YangModeledAnyXmlSchemaNode yangModeledAnyXMLSchemaNode) {
  requireNonNull(yangModeledAnyXMLSchemaNode, "Yang modeled any xml node must not be null.");
  super.withNodeIdentifier(NodeIdentifier.create(yangModeledAnyXMLSchemaNode.getQName()));
  this.contentSchema = yangModeledAnyXMLSchemaNode.getSchemaOfAnyXmlData();
}

代码示例来源:origin: opendaylight/yangtools

DataSchemaNode parentSchema = parent.getSchema();
if (parentSchema instanceof YangModeledAnyXmlSchemaNode) {
  parentSchema = ((YangModeledAnyXmlSchemaNode) parentSchema).getSchemaOfAnyXmlData();

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com